WebBlue cheese (or bleu cheese) is semi-soft cheese with a sharp, salty flavor. It is made with cultures of the edible mold Penicillium, giving it spots or veins throughout the cheese in shades of blue or green.It carries a … WebFirst, for Cheeses that you are meant to eat moldy, like Bleu cheese, they are very specific kinds of mold that are grown and cultivated like other foods then mixed in/added with the cheese. It isn’t just random mold growing on it. These are known to be safe and are used to enhance smell/flavor.

The most common types of mold used to grow cheese are Penicillium (P.) roqueforti, … WebApr 15, 2024 · Soft cheeses like Brie or Port-Salut should have about a quarter-inch cut away from any surface where mold is visible. Harder, aged cheeses, like aged Cheddar or Parmesan can just have the mold scraped away. There are two main steps in the cheesemaking process - … WebDec 21, 2024 · Brie is an off-white, soft-ripened cheese, usually made from cow's milk. It has a bloomy rind of white mold, which is considered to be a delicacy. Brie originated in Seine-et-Marne, France, and is a soft farmhouse cheese. The flavor of brie is rich, buttery, fruity, and increasingly earthy with age.
